The phrase "feedback was solicited" is correct and usable in written English.
It can be used when indicating that input or opinions were requested from others regarding a specific topic or project.
Example: "After the presentation, feedback was solicited from the audience to improve future sessions."
Alternatives: "input was requested" or "opinions were sought".
